The Vertical Profile of Phosphate on the Baru Lake in Buluh Cina Village Siak Hulu Subdistrict Kampar District Amat Marustar Siregar; Asmika H. Simarmata; Madju Siagian
Jurnal Online Mahasiswa (JOM) Bidang Perikanan dan Ilmu Kelautan Vol 1, No 1 (2014): Wisuda Februari Tahun 2014
Publisher : Jurnal Online Mahasiswa (JOM) Bidang Perikanan dan Ilmu Kelautan

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

This research has been done on the Baru Lake Buluh Cina Village Siak Hulu SubdistrictDistrict Kampar from March - April 2013. This research aims to understand the vertical profile ofphosphate in this lake. The researh used survey method. Sample were taken horizontally in threestation and vertically in three sampling point. The water quality parameters measured were pH,dissolved oxygen (DO), based on transparancy, temperature and depth.The concentration of phosphate was 0,016 - 0,113 mg/l. The value of pH was 6. Theconcentration of dissolved oxygen (DO) was 2,6 – 5,47 mg/l. Based on transparancy was 47,0 -55,8 cm. Temperature was 29 – 30,3ºC. Depth was 346 – 409 cm. Phosphate consentration insurface was 0,016 – 0,037 mg/l, while in bottom was 0,063 – 0,113 mg/l. The vertical profile ofphosphate in bottom was higher than in the surface. The parameters of water quality were observedstill sustain the aquatic organism life.Keywords: phosphate, vertical profile, Baru Lake
The Vertical Profiles of Phytoplankton in Danau Pinang Luar Buluh CinaVillage, Siak Hulu Sub- District, District Kampar, Riau Province Sudirman Sihombing; Madju siagian; Clemens Sihotang
Jurnal Online Mahasiswa (JOM) Bidang Perikanan dan Ilmu Kelautan Vol 1, No 1 (2014): Wisuda Februari Tahun 2014
Publisher : Jurnal Online Mahasiswa (JOM) Bidang Perikanan dan Ilmu Kelautan

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

This research was conducted on the Danau Pinang Luar Buluh Cina Village Siak HuluSubdistrict District Kampar Riau Province in April - Mei 2013 and aims to understand thephytoplankton vertical rofil in the Pinang Luar Lake. There were 3 stations, station 1 isincomingwater area, Station 2 is agencies lake area. Station 3 is end of the lake area. Samplings wereconducted 3 times, once/week.This research aims to determine the vertical profile ofphytoplankton of Danau Pinang Luar.The results showed 24 species of phytoplankton were classified into four classes, namely:Chlorophyceae (11 species), Cyanophyceae (7 species),Bacillariophyceae (5 species), Euglenophyceae (1 species). Average phytoplankton abundancearound 61578 - 495112 cells/l, species diversity index (H ') of phytoplankton around 4,21 - 4,51,uniformity index around 0,87 - 0,93 and dominance index (C) of about 0,046- 0,063. While thewater quality parameters such as temperature of 31°C, the brightness around 65 - 70 cm, a depth ofapproximately 261,7 - 461.7 cm, pH 6, Dissolved Oxygen approximately 2,93 – 6,4 mg/l, free ofcarbon dioxide around 3,96 – 11,88 mg/l, Nitrate around 0,01-0,02 mg/l, Phosphate approximately0,023 mg/l. Based on the abundance of phytoplankton, concluded that Danau Pinang Luar Outerrelatively moderate fertility levels.Keyword : Phytoplankton, Buluh Cina Village, Danau Pinang Luar
Diversity of Plankton in the Part of Upstream Siak River Palas Village, Pekanbaru City, Riau Province Sri Rahayu; Efawani '; Yuliati '
Jurnal Online Mahasiswa (JOM) Bidang Perikanan dan Ilmu Kelautan Vol 1, No 1 (2014): Wisuda Februari Tahun 2014
Publisher : Jurnal Online Mahasiswa (JOM) Bidang Perikanan dan Ilmu Kelautan

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

A study on the diversity of plankton in the part of upstream Siak River wasconducted from Mei-Juli 2013. This research aims to understand the abundance anddiversity of plankton in that area. There were three stations with 3 sampling points ineach station. Samples were taken 3 times, once a week and they were analyzed in theAquatic Ecology and Environmental Management Laboratory of the Fisheries andMarine Science Faculty, Riau University.Result shown that the phytoplankton obtained were consist of 25 species, theywere belonged to of 3 classes, namely Chlorophyceae (10 species), Bacillariophyceae(7 species), and Cyanophyceae (8 species). The average of fitoplankton abundance wasaround 1261-2540 cells/l. The most common phytoplankton was Planktonema sp.(334 cells/l, Chlorophyceae). Diversity index (H') was 2,91–3,07, equitability index (E)was 0,90–0,95 and dominancy index (C) was 0,05–0,08 and result shown that thezooplankton obtained were consist of 10 species, they were belonged to of 3 classes,namely Rotifera (5 species), Ciliata (3 species), and Copepoda (2 species). The averageof zooplankton abundance was around 414-530 inds/l. The most common zooplanktonwas Notholca sp. (88 inds/l, Rotifera). Diversity index (H') was 2,08-2,27, equitabilityindex (E) was 0,90–0,99 and dominancy index (C) was 0,11–0,12. General waterquality parameters are as follow: temperature: 29,3-30,3 0C, brightness: 30-33 cm,current speed: 0,11-0,18 m/s, pH: 5-6, DO: 3–3,4 mg/l, CO2: 8,98–10,98 mg/l, nitrate:0,11–0,14 mg/l and phosphate 0,015–0,019 mg/l. Based on plankton abundance, theSiak River can be categorized as oligotriphic river.Keywords : Plankton Abundance, Phytoplankton, Zooplankton, Upstream Siak River

Comparison of line fishing catches after and before installed the fish agregating device(FAD’s) Muhammad Muammar; Arthur Brown; Pareng Rengi
Jurnal Online Mahasiswa (JOM) Bidang Perikanan dan Ilmu Kelautan Vol 1, No 1 (2014): Wisuda Februari Tahun 2014
Publisher : Jurnal Online Mahasiswa (JOM) Bidang Perikanan dan Ilmu Kelautan

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

For purpose to compare line fishing catches, which its were set close at FAD’s device and without FAD’s. Series fishing ctivities were carried out at fishing ground with FAD’s and without FAD’s during July 3rd -13th, 2013 in Teluk Rhu village, North Rupat district, Bengkalis regency, Indonesia. The result show that the composition and number of line fishing catches was signficatly different from T test to the weight of fish Thit = 5.37> Ttab = 1.833, this means Thit> Ttab, Ho is rejected and Hais accepted.with FAD’s and without FAD’s. The line fishing catches by FAD’s  was caugth 1.3 kg (3 individuals) snapper, 0.9 (3 individuals) groupers and 0.4 kg (1individual) puffer fish. While, the line fishing catches without FAD’s was 8 kg (5 individuals)  groupers, 3.1 kg (4 individuals) snappers, 4.6 kg (3 individuals) stingrays, 2.6 kg (3 individuals) croakers and 6 kg (3 individuals) spines.   Keywords: Fish agregating device(FAD’s), line fishing, Teluk Rhu village,  
Comparison of the stability of the boat with and without the use of cadik Syafriadi '; Jonny Zain; Ronald . M Hutauruk
Jurnal Online Mahasiswa (JOM) Bidang Perikanan dan Ilmu Kelautan Vol 1, No 1 (2014): Wisuda Februari Tahun 2014
Publisher : Jurnal Online Mahasiswa (JOM) Bidang Perikanan dan Ilmu Kelautan

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

This study was conducted on 24 April to 7 May 2013, which took place in the village of Lohong. The purpose of this study was to assess the stability of the boat with and without the use of cadik over the stability curve Hidromax software. The method used in this study is asurvey method. Boat primary measure obtained is 8 m LOA, LPP 6 m, 7 m LWL, loaded 0.6 m,0.8 m high and 1 m wide boat. results of the analysis indicate that the boat using cadik rate stability is better than that not using cadik boats, where the maximum heigh tis 0,429 GZ cadik boats rad m-high and boats without cadik GZ is 0.262 m-rad, the difference is caused by the addition of cadik because the cadik on the boat could improve the stability of the boat and if the boat motion, cadik also reserve buoyancy for the boatKeywords: stability of the boat, cadik, software Hidromax
